Aluminum sheets are widely used in the aerospace industry due to their high strength, low density, good corrosion resistance, and other excellent properties. The following are different applications of aluminum sheets and their corresponding requirements in the aerospace industry.
1. Aircraft Skin
Aluminum sheets are commonly used as aircraft skin to provide a smooth surface for aerodynamic performance and structural strength. Requirements for aluminum sheets in aircraft skin include high strength-to-weight ratio, good formability, excellent corrosion resistance, and compatibility with various coatings to enhance durability.
2. Fuselage
Aluminum sheets are also widely used in the fuselage structure of aircraft. Requirements for aluminum sheets in aircraft fuselages include high strength, fatigue resistance, good weldability, and compatibility with various adhesives and sealants to ensure the structural integrity and safety of the aircraft.
3. Wing and Tail Surfaces
Aluminum sheets are commonly used in wing and tail surfaces of aircraft to provide structural support and aerodynamic lift. Requirements for aluminum sheets in aircraft wing and tail surfaces include high strength, low density, good formability, and compatibility with various coatings and joining methods to achieve optimal aerodynamic performance.
4. Engine Components
Aluminum sheets are increasingly being used in engine components such as casings, cylinders, and heat shields due to their lightweight and high-temperature resistance properties. Requirements for aluminum sheets in aircraft engine components include high thermal conductivity, excellent mechanical properties at high temperatures, and compatibility with various coatings and joining methods to enhance performance and durability.
